Makefile.in: Use only one resource file per binary.
authorDanilo Almeida <dalmeida@mit.edu>
Tue, 18 May 1999 00:17:17 +0000 (00:17 +0000)
committerDanilo Almeida <dalmeida@mit.edu>
Tue, 18 May 1999 00:17:17 +0000 (00:17 +0000)
krb5.rc: Remove silly _MSDOS #ifdef.

git-svn-id: svn://anonsvn.mit.edu/krb5/trunk@11459 dc483132-0cff-0310-8789-dd5450dbe970

src/lib/ChangeLog
src/lib/Makefile.in
src/lib/krb5.rc

index c70cc9a1d03d6d3646157b2045bb8add8e9587a0..4bab41370f8989b2cad357d880a0bb13744122f3 100644 (file)
@@ -1,3 +1,9 @@
+Mon May 17 19:50:53 1999  Danilo Almeida  <dalmeida@mit.edu>
+
+       * Makefile.in: Use only one resource file per binary.
+
+       * krb5.rc: Remove silly _MSDOS #ifdef.
+
 Mon May 17 12:37:25 1999  Danilo Almeida  <dalmeida@mit.edu>
 
        * Makefile.in: Get rid of win16 support/clutter.  Build separate
index 9a9c44448cc2477278e6029566278de30112bde5..f80486579fb6ea61199b872669ccb3941db5568a 100644 (file)
@@ -54,7 +54,7 @@ SKDEF = krb5_32.def
 SGLIB = $(OUTPRE)sapgss32.lib
 SKLIB = $(OUTPRE)sapkrb32.lib
 
-KRB5RES = $(OUTPRE)krb5.res
+KRB5RC = krb5.rc
 VERSIONRC = $(BUILDTOP)\windows\version.rc
 
 WINLIBS = kernel32.lib wsock32.lib user32.lib shell32.lib oldnames.lib \
@@ -74,60 +74,59 @@ GGLUE=$(GSS_GLUE)
 K4GLUE=$(K4_GLUE)
 SKGLUE=$(SAP_GLUE)
 
-VER_RC_FLAGS=$(CPPFLAGS) -D_WIN32 -D_MSDOS_ -DRES_ONLY
-
-##WIN32##CVER=$(CLIB:.lib=.res)
-##WIN32##PVER=$(PLIB:.lib=.res)
-##WIN32##KVER=$(KLIB:.lib=.res)
-##WIN32##GVER=$(GLIB:.lib=.res)
-##WIN32##K4VER=$(K4LIB:.lib=.res)
-##WIN32##SKVER=$(SKLIB:.lib=.res)
-##WIN32##SGVER=$(SGLIB:.lib=.res)
-
-##WIN32##$(CVER): $(VERSIONRC)
-##WIN32##      $(RC) $(VER_RC_FLAGS) -DCE_LIB -fo $@ -r $**
-##WIN32##$(PVER): $(VERSIONRC)
-##WIN32##      $(RC) $(VER_RC_FLAGS) -DPROF_LIB -fo $@ -r $**
-##WIN32##$(KVER): $(VERSIONRC)
-##WIN32##      $(RC) $(VER_RC_FLAGS) -DKRB5_LIB -fo $@ -r $**
-##WIN32##$(K4VER): $(VERSIONRC)
-##WIN32##      $(RC) $(VER_RC_FLAGS) -DKRB4_LIB -fo $@ -r $**
-##WIN32##$(GVER): $(VERSIONRC)
-##WIN32##      $(RC) $(VER_RC_FLAGS) -DGSSAPI_LIB -fo $@ -r $**
-##WIN32##$(SKVER): $(VERSIONRC)
-##WIN32##      $(RC) $(VER_RC_FLAGS) -DSAPKRB_LIB -fo $@ -r $**
-##WIN32##$(SGVER): $(VERSIONRC)
-##WIN32##      $(RC) $(VER_RC_FLAGS) -DSAPGSS_LIB -fo $@ -r $**
-
-##WIN32##$(CLIB): $(CDEF) $(CLIBS) $(CGLUE) $(CVER)
+RCFLAGS=$(CPPFLAGS) -D_WIN32 -D_MSDOS_ -DRES_ONLY
+
+##WIN32##CRES=$(CLIB:.lib=.res)
+##WIN32##PRES=$(PLIB:.lib=.res)
+##WIN32##KRES=$(KLIB:.lib=.res)
+##WIN32##GRES=$(GLIB:.lib=.res)
+##WIN32##K4RES=$(K4LIB:.lib=.res)
+##WIN32##SKRES=$(SKLIB:.lib=.res)
+##WIN32##SGRES=$(SGLIB:.lib=.res)
+
+##WIN32##$(CRES): $(VERSIONRC)
+##WIN32##      $(RC) $(RCFLAGS) -DCE_LIB -fo $@ -r $**
+##WIN32##$(PRES): $(VERSIONRC)
+##WIN32##      $(RC) $(RCFLAGS) -DPROF_LIB -fo $@ -r $**
+##WIN32##$(KRES): $(KRB5RC)
+##WIN32##      $(RC) $(RCFLAGS) -DKRB5_LIB -fo $@ -r $**
+##WIN32##$(K4RES): $(VERSIONRC)
+##WIN32##      $(RC) $(RCFLAGS) -DKRB4_LIB -fo $@ -r $**
+##WIN32##$(GRES): $(VERSIONRC)
+##WIN32##      $(RC) $(RCFLAGS) -DGSSAPI_LIB -fo $@ -r $**
+##WIN32##$(SKRES): $(KRB5RC)
+##WIN32##      $(RC) $(RCFLAGS) -DSAPKRB_LIB -fo $@ -r $**
+##WIN32##$(SGRES): $(VERSIONRC)
+##WIN32##      $(RC) $(RCFLAGS) -DSAPGSS_LIB -fo $@ -r $**
+##WIN32##$(KRB5RC): $(VERSIONRC)
+
+##WIN32##$(CLIB): $(CDEF) $(CLIBS) $(CGLUE) $(CRES)
 ##WIN32##      link $(WINDLLFLAGS) -def:$(CDEF) -out:$*.dll \
-##WIN32##        $(CLIBS) $(CGLUE) $(CVER) $(WINLIBS)
+##WIN32##        $(CLIBS) $(CGLUE) $(CRES) $(WINLIBS)
 
-##WIN32##$(PLIB): $(PDEF) $(PLIBS) $(PGLUE) $(PVER) $(CLIB)
+##WIN32##$(PLIB): $(PDEF) $(PLIBS) $(PGLUE) $(PRES) $(CLIB)
 ##WIN32##      link $(WINDLLFLAGS) -def:$(PDEF) -out:$*.dll \
-##WIN32##        $(PLIBS) $(PGLUE) $(PVER) $(CLIB) $(WINLIBS)
+##WIN32##        $(PLIBS) $(PGLUE) $(PRES) $(CLIB) $(WINLIBS)
 
-##WIN32##$(KLIB): $(KDEF) $(KLIBS) $(KGLUE) $(KVER) $(KRB5RES) $(CLIB) $(MITLIBS)
+##WIN32##$(KLIB): $(KDEF) $(KLIBS) $(KGLUE) $(KRES) $(CLIB) $(MITLIBS)
 ##WIN32##      link $(WINDLLFLAGS) -def:$(KDEF) -out:$*.dll \
-##WIN32##        $(KLIBS) $(KGLUE) $(KVER) $(KRB5RES) $(CLIB) $(MITLIBS) \
-##WIN32##        $(WINLIBS)
+##WIN32##        $(KLIBS) $(KGLUE) $(KRES) $(CLIB) $(MITLIBS) $(WINLIBS)
 
-##WIN32##$(GLIB): $(GDEF) $(GLIBS) $(GGLUE) $(GVER) $(KLIB) $(CLIB)
+##WIN32##$(GLIB): $(GDEF) $(GLIBS) $(GGLUE) $(GRES) $(KLIB) $(CLIB)
 ##WIN32##      link $(WINDLLFLAGS) -def:$(GDEF) -out:$*.dll \
-##WIN32##        $(GLIBS) $(GGLUE) $(GVER) $(KLIB) $(CLIB) $(WINLIBS)
+##WIN32##        $(GLIBS) $(GGLUE) $(GRES) $(KLIB) $(CLIB) $(WINLIBS)
 
-##WIN32##$(K4LIB): $(K4DEF) $(K4LIBS) $(K4GLUE) $(K4VER) $(KLIB) $(CLIB) $(PLIB)
+##WIN32##$(K4LIB): $(K4DEF) $(K4LIBS) $(K4GLUE) $(K4RES) $(KLIB) $(CLIB) $(PLIB)
 ##WIN32##      link $(WINDLLFLAGS) -def:$(K4DEF) -out:$*.dll \
-##WIN32##        $(K4LIBS) $(K4GLUE) $(K4VER) $(KLIB) $(CLIB) $(PLIB) $(WINLIBS)
+##WIN32##        $(K4LIBS) $(K4GLUE) $(K4RES) $(KLIB) $(CLIB) $(PLIB) $(WINLIBS)
 
-##WIN32##$(SKLIB): $(KDEF) $(KLIBS) $(SKGLUE) $(SKVER) $(KRB5RES) $(CLIB) $(MITLIBS)
+##WIN32##$(SKLIB): $(KDEF) $(KLIBS) $(SKGLUE) $(SKRES) $(CLIB) $(MITLIBS)
 ##WIN32##      link $(WINDLLFLAGS) -def:$(KDEF) -out:$*.dll \
-##WIN32##        $(KLIBS) $(SKGLUE) $(SKVER) $(KRB5RES) $(CLIB) $(MITLIBS) \
-##WIN32##        $(WINLIBS)
+##WIN32##        $(KLIBS) $(SKGLUE) $(SKRES) $(CLIB) $(MITLIBS) $(WINLIBS)
 
-##WIN32##$(SGLIB): $(GDEF) $(GLIBS) $(GGLUE) $(SGVER) $(SKLIB) $(CLIB) $(MITLIBS)
+##WIN32##$(SGLIB): $(GDEF) $(GLIBS) $(GGLUE) $(SGRES) $(SKLIB) $(CLIB) $(MITLIBS)
 ##WIN32##      link $(WINDLLFLAGS) -def:$(GDEF) -out:$*.dll \
-##WIN32##        $(GLIBS) $(GGLUE) $(SGVER) $(SKLIB) $(CLIB) $(MITLIBS) $(WINLIBS)
+##WIN32##        $(GLIBS) $(GGLUE) $(SGRES) $(SKLIB) $(CLIB) $(MITLIBS) $(WINLIBS)
 
 ##MIT##lib-windows:: $(SKLIB) $(SGLIB) 
 
@@ -142,9 +141,6 @@ $(GSS_GLUE): win_glue.c
 $(NO_GLUE): win_glue.c
        $(CC) $(CFLAGS) /c /Fo$@ $**
 
-$(KRB5RES): krb5.rc
-       $(RC) $(CPPFLAGS) -DKRB5 -fo $@ -r $**
-
 # Build Convenience
 comerr.lib: $(CLIB)
 krb4.lib:   $(K4LIB)
index 0fe10ecf9a34867d368e89597e371e30d17edc34..9fc24289b812ad6e4f007c94eda4ed2a4c232e16 100644 (file)
@@ -38,6 +38,4 @@ FONT 8, "Helv"
   PUSHBUTTON "&Cancel", IDCANCEL, 107, 61, 40, 14
 }
 
-#ifdef _MSDOS
 #include "..\windows\version.rc"
-#endif